Find the greatest common factor of 8m 3 and 6m 4
irina [24]

ANSWER

2{m}^{3}

EXPLANATION

The expressions are

8 {m}^{3}  =  {2}^{3}  \times  {m}^{3}

and

6 {m}^{4}  = 2 \times 3 {m}^{4}

The greatest common factor is the product the least powers of the common factors.

= 2 {m}^{3}

A photograph of a painting measures 13 units by 17 units. If the scale factor is 1/3, what is the actual size of the painting?
Vlad1618 [11]

Answer:

39 units by 51 units

Step-by-step explanation:

The painting is a scale factor of 1/3, so each side length is 1/3 of the original.  To find the original multiply both side lengths by 3.

13x3 = 39

17 x 3 = 51
